Below the menu is a standard toolbar (also called a button bar or ribbon). This toolbar contains shortcuts for several of the most commonly used menu commands. If you move the mouse over the tool for about two seconds, an explanation of the tool (balloon help or tool tip) appears on the screen. As with most software packages, the toolbar can be hidden if you so choose (right click on any of the toolbars or use View, Toolbars, Customize). Hiding the toolbar allows for more room on the screen for the problems. As is the case with most toolbars, they float. In order to reposition any of the toolbars, simply click on the handle on the left and drag.
If you are a myomlab user then the toolbar will appear as below with two extra tools to be used for pasting from myomlab. The first tool performs the paste and the second gives help on pasting from myomlab, if needed.
